A torque converter is a tool inside of an automated transmission housing established involving the motor and the gears. Primarily a complicated hydraulic fluid coupling, the torque converter transmits and multiplies motor torque though also making it possible for the car to return to an entire stop devoid of touching or shifting the transmission.

A torque converter serves to enhance transmitted torque if the output rotational velocity is low. In the fluid coupling embodiment, it works by using a fluid, pushed with the vanes of an enter impeller, and directed from the vanes of a hard and fast stator, to drive an output turbine in this kind of fashion that torque around the output is greater if the output shaft is rotating a lot more little by little in pemilik website comparison to the enter shaft, Consequently supplying the equivalent of an adaptive reduction equipment.
Though not strictly a Element of typical torque converter design, a lot of automotive converters contain a lock-up clutch to improve cruising electric power transmission performance and cut down heat.
This motion normally takes place at cruising speeds wherever the engine load is moderate and effectiveness gains from a locked relationship are maximized.
The torque converter clutch comes into motion to mitigate the inherent inefficiency from the fluid coupling at higher speeds.
